    Yeah I know. I like that part of history. Also I heard that the reason why the Dutch had the opportunity to throw a revolt, was because the Spanish king took away his troops. He took away his troops because the Ottomans were attacking Venice who's leader was family of the king of Spain and asked to borrow some troops. The reason the king of Spain chose his troops in the Netherlands was cause those Dutch were really quiet people and didn't really make much of a fuss.

    So when the Dutch started to make 'problems' due to the rules, there weren't enough troops to squish us and the 80 year war started. (Does this mean we have to thank Turkey?) Then to think that if Spain had just allowed our requests we wouldn't have whooped their butts so hard and then start the Golden age.
